Linuxに関するkataseのブックマーク (12)

  • Linuxの使い方 - シェルスクリプトの作り方(1/8)

    6. シェルスクリプトの作り方(1/8) 6.1 概要 UNIX系OSでは実行したいコマンドをファイルに記述しておき、コマンド名として、そのファイルを指定することにより、ファイル中のコマンドを実行することが出来ます。このコマンドを記述したファイルをシェルスクリプトと呼んでいます。シェルスクリプトに記述するコマンドの形式は、ターミナル・エミュレータ上で実行するときとまったく同じですし、ファイルは普通のテキストファイルです。また、コンパイルのような前処理も必要ありません。 ここでは、次の内容について説明します。 実行方法とよく使うコマンド シェル変数と文字列演算 位置パラメータ(引数の取り扱い) 文字列のエスケープ 四則演算 制御演算 関数 【図6-1】例題のシェルスクリプトの実行環境 コマンドサーチパスの設定をしているため、コマンド名としてファイル名を指定すれば実行できます 以降の説明での例

  • 【インフォシーク】Infoseek : 楽天が運営するポータルサイト

    日頃より楽天のサービスをご利用いただきましてありがとうございます。 サービスをご利用いただいておりますところ大変申し訳ございませんが、現在、緊急メンテナンスを行わせていただいております。 お客様には、緊急のメンテナンスにより、ご迷惑をおかけしており、誠に申し訳ございません。 メンテナンスが終了次第、サービスを復旧いたしますので、 今しばらくお待ちいただけますよう、お願い申し上げます。

  • Native Win32 ports of some GNU utilities

    Here are some ports of common GNU utilities to native Win32. In this context, native means the executables do only depend on the Microsoft C-runtime (msvcrt.dll) and not an emulation layer like that provided by Cygwin tools. Download: by http: UnxUtils.zip by ftp: no FTP mirror at the moment latest updates (after 14-04-03):  UnxUpdates.zip Source code: I have started an Open source project at http

  • GNU Bash for Windows

    This page is orphaned, abandoned, and unmaintained. No further updates will be made to this page, and accuracy is neither expected nor guaranteed. It is left in place solely for historical interest. GNU BASH For Windows GNU BASH is a shell which is modelled after the original Bourne shell, and is installed as the default shell upon most installations of GNU/Linux. This page allows you to download

  • GrubからWindowsを起動する - Hysoft Wiki - Hysoft - SourceForge.JP

    katase
    katase 2009/10/26
  • GPartedでNTFSパーティションを操作するには - @IT

    GPartedでパーティションを操作するにはで、GPartedのインストールや操作方法について説明した。 GPartedの初期設定で操作可能なファイルシステムは、ext2/3、FAT16/32、ReiserFSなどに限定されているが、各ファイルシステムに対応したパーティション編集ツールを追加することにより、NTFSなどの変更も可能になる。 注:パーティションの操作では、プログラムのバグやハードウェア的な要因などで、ハードディスク上のデータが破壊されることがある。作業を行う際は、事前に必要なファイルのバックアップを取っておくことをお勧めする。また、作業は自己責任で行ってほしい。ちなみに、筆者は商用製品やフリーソフトウェアといった区別とは無関係に、データが破壊された経験がある。 GPartedでNTFSパーティションの編集を行うには、ntfsprogsというソフトウェアが必要となる。ntfsp

    katase
    katase 2009/10/23
  • [覚書]vimでsjisのファイルを開いたら文字化け。対処法は?

    vi(ホントはvim)でうっかり(古き良き時代の)sjisファイルを開いて文字化けして困惑。 程よく自分向けにチューニングを施されたLinux環境ならsjisファイルも素直に開けるが、インストールしたばかりの真新しいLinux環境に、まして日人専用でもない代物に、かような緻密さを要求するというのは恥ずかしい。それに時代の潮流はasciiの亡霊^H^H^H^H^H ^H^H^Hutf-8だし。 それに出先とか他人様の環境で~/.vimrcを弄くるなんてちょっと無能すぎるとか、いつも使うファイルはeucとutf-8でsjisやらは稀とか、文字コード認識がいつもうまく機能するとは限らないとか等など、一時的な文字コードの指定法を知っとくと役に立つ。 なーんて下らない話は置いておいて、次の通り。 vi(vim)でファイルを開いて、文字化けしているところで次を打つ。exコマンドだわね :set fi

    [覚書]vimでsjisのファイルを開いたら文字化け。対処法は?
  • @IT:tarボールからRPMファイルを作成するには

    Red Hat Linuxなどはパッケージ管理システムとしてRPMを採用しているが、インストールしたいプログラムがtarボールのみで配布されていることも多い。多くの場合、tarボールを展開してコンパイルを行い、インストールするのは簡単だ。しかし、この方法でインストールしたプログラムはRPMの管理からは外れてしまうので、RPMによって得られるサービス(インストール済みプログラムの検索やプログラムのアップグレードなど)が受けらない。 tarボールで配布されているプログラムの中には、RPMファイルを作成するためのSPECファイルを含んでいるものがある。このような場合は、rpmbuildコマンドでtarボールからRPMファイルを作成できる。具体的には、-taオプションを付けてrpmbuildコマンドを実行する。

    katase
    katase 2009/10/10
  • @IT:ソースファイルからRPMファイルを作成するには

    インストールしたいプログラムが、tarボールのみで配布されていることも多い。しかし、ソースファイルをそのままコンパイル/インストールすると、RPMによる恩恵(インストール済みプログラムの検索やプログラムのアップグレードなど)が得られないので、プログラムはできるだけRPMファイルでインストールしたいものだ。 「tarボールからRPMファイルを作成するには」で説明したとおり、SPECファイルが用意されていればrpmbuildコマンドでtarボールからRPMファイルを作成できる。しかし、ここで紹介するCheckInstallを使うと、SPECファイルが用意されていなくてもRPMファイルを作成できる。 まず、CheckInstallのWebサイト(http://asic-linux.com.mx/~izto/checkinstall/)からソースファイルをダウンロードしてインストールする。原稿執筆

    katase
    katase 2009/10/10
  • パソコンおやじ

    [ 自宅サーバーWebRing ┃前 |ID=72 前 後5表示 |次 ┃乱 移動 |サ イト一覧 ] パ ソコンおやじのHPは、Linux(SuSE9.3)/ Athlon64サーバ/Bフレッツマンションタイプ(VDSL方式)で運用しています。 サーバ初心者のおやじが、無謀にもLinuxに挑戦しました。現在、試行錯誤の末、WWW/メール/FTP/DNS/Proxy サーバが稼働中です。SMTP Authentication、POP/SSL等、セキュリティを考慮したシステムを目指しています。 ■FileZilla Server0.9.44の日語化パッチをダウンロードに 追加しました。(2014.05.04) ■FileZilla Server0.9.43の日語化パッチをダウンロードに 追加しました。(2014.01.04) ■FileZilla Server0.9.42の日語化パッチ

  • GNU screen いろいろまとめ。 - naoyaのはてなダイアリー:

    先日人力検索で GNU screen の設定TIPSについて質問してみたところ、かなーり役立つ設定とかをたくさん教えてもらうことができました。みなさん感謝。 そんで、教えていただいた通りにカスタマイズした結果、こんな感じのスクリーンショットが撮れました。MacOSX のターミナルです。 おかげさまでかなり便利になって作業効率が上がったと思います。いろいろ教えてもらったお礼とまではいきませんが、やった設定とかをはまりどころとかも交えて紹介してみます。名付けてリバースNDOメソッド。ちなみに、知ってる人にはごく当然のことが当たり前のように書いてるので、あんまり役に立たないかもしれません。 hardstatus alwayslastline で最終行にウィンドウ一覧を表示 これは今回の質問とは直接関係ないのですが、やるとやらないとでかなり使い勝手が違うので。 hardstatus alwaysl

    katase
    katase 2009/06/21
  • named.conf の設定

    ### /etc/named.conf root:root 644 ### acl "internal-acl" { 127/8; 192.168.0/24; }; include "/etc/rndc.key"; controls { inet 127.0.0.1 port 953 allow { 127.0.0.1; } keys { rndc-key; }; }; include "/etc/host1.key"; logging { channel "default_syslog" { syslog daemon; severity info; }; channel "default_debug" { file "named.run"; severity dynamic; }; channel "null" { null; }; category "unmatched" { "nu

  • 1